Meaning of Bahat:

Bahat is a Hebrew name meaning 'to shine' or 'to radiate'. It signifies a shining light or a radiant energy. The name Bahat represents someone who brings brightness, positivity, and vitality to those around them. It reflects a person who illuminates the lives of others with their presence.

  • Gender: Boy
  • Origin: Hebrew, Arabic

Origin:

Hebrew , Arabic
